Former United States Solicitor General Kenneth Starr spoke about the concept of federalism and constitutional issues. He reviewed the decisions of the 1996-1997 Supreme Court term which was recently concluded. He talked about how several of the cases decided this term dealt with the idea of the relationship between the federal government and the states and between the state and the individual.
